public final class JobManager
extends org.lcsim.job.JobControlManager
Provides setup of database conditions system and adds option to provide conditions system tags.
Constructor and Description |
---|
JobManager()
Class constructor.
|
Modifier and Type | Method and Description |
---|---|
protected org.apache.commons.cli.Options |
createCommandLineOptions()
Override creation of command line options.
|
DatabaseConditionsManagerSetup |
getDatabaseConditionsManagerSetup()
Get the conditions setup.
|
static void |
main(String[] args)
Run the job manager from the command line.
|
org.apache.commons.cli.CommandLine |
parse(String[] args)
Override command line parsing.
|
addInputFile, addVariableDefinition, configure, enableHeadlessMode, finish, getConditionsSetup, getDriverAdapter, getDriverExecList, getLCSimLoop, getOptions, initializeLoop, processEvent, run, setConditionsSetup, setDryRun, setEventPrintInterval, setNumberOfEvents, setup, setup, setup, setupDrivers
public static void main(String[] args)
args
- the command line argumentspublic DatabaseConditionsManagerSetup getDatabaseConditionsManagerSetup()
protected org.apache.commons.cli.Options createCommandLineOptions()
createCommandLineOptions
in class org.lcsim.job.JobControlManager
public org.apache.commons.cli.CommandLine parse(String[] args)
parse
in class org.lcsim.job.JobControlManager
Copyright © 2019. All rights reserved.